Abstract

The invention relates to a preparation method of a modified starch surface sizing agent and belongs to the technical field of sizing agent preparation. The preparation method includes firstly, subjecting cassava starch to oxidation treatment by hydrogen peroxide and an ethanol solution; then, performing sulfonation treatment under the condition of ice-water bath with chlorosulfonic acid and glacial acetic acid added so as to obtain modified cassava starch; thirdly, subjecting Bacillus stearothermophilus to selective culture by a selective culture medium to obtain a bacterium, and modifying the modified cassava starch by the bacterium to enhance hydrophobicity; finally, adding natural chitin both as a binding agent and for enhancing an antibacterial effect so as to obtain the modified starch surface sizing agent. The modified starch surface sizing agent prepared according to the preparation method is less prone to mildewing, a coated film layer is less prone to cracking and damping, and accordingly epoxy strength and water resistance of paper are improved.

Background technology
With the continuous development of current papermaking, printing and association area, paper and paperboard surface are improved for Cypres The requirement of performance and printing adaptability also more and more higher.The preparation of Cypres is increasingly paid attention to by paper-making industry, it with Papermaking material structure adjustment, development trend of mode of printing variation, high speed and paper products high-quality etc. are relevant, so table The effect of face applying glue and its advantage seem especially prominent.Top sizing processes and directly acts on paper surface, overcomes interior interpolation Paper machine systemic contamination that auxiliary agent exists, foaming, high temperature are manufactured paper with pulp degree of sizing low sequence of operations sex chromosome mosaicism.
Conventional Cypres have alkyl ketene dimer sizing agent, and it has preferable water repelling property, but there is Poor with the affinity of fiber, the contribution to ring pressure and deflection is little, emulsion facile hydrolysis impact sizing efficiency within storage period, and There is the maturation period, that is, after machine under paper, certain time to be crossed can be only achieved maximum degree of sizing, due to inhaling within the maturation period Receiving moisture makes ring crush intensity decline by a big margin, and so that water-resistance has also been declined simultaneously.It is proposed that using natural polymer Cypres(Mainly starch and its modifier), starch and its modifier are the most frequently used carriers, modified starch with The adhesion of fiber more preferably, has certain improvement result to paper products hair and powder dropping, but after being dried, film layer embrittlement is easy to crack, after making moist Surfaces of tacky, affects water-resistance and the ring crush intensity of paper, and in addition starch easily goes mouldy, and emulsion can be caused to go bad, therefore applying glue Effect is not often good enough.

For solving above-mentioned technical problem, the technical solution used in the present invention is:
(1)Count by weight, take 40~50 portions of tapiocas, 60~70 parts of mass fractions to be 70% ethanol solution, 12~16 Part chlorosulfonic acid, 14~19 parts of mass fractions are 15% hydrogen peroxide and 12~15 parts of glacial acetic acid, first successively by above-mentioned parts by weight Tapioca, mass fraction be that 70% ethanol solution and mass fraction are put into agitator, thermometer for 15% hydrogen peroxide And in the four-hole boiling flask of dropping funel, and four-hole boiling flask is placed in water-bath, design temperature is 55~60 DEG C, with 300r/min Stirring 1~2h;
(2)After above-mentioned stirring terminates, four-hole boiling flask is placed in ice-water bath, then by the chlorosulfonic acid of above-mentioned parts by weight and ice vinegar Acid mixes, and obtains mixed liquor, and is added dropwise in four-hole boiling flask using dropping funel, and control rate of addition is 2/s, with 250r/min is stirred, and continues stirring 3~6h, subsequently take out four-hole boiling flask, using 1.5mol/L hydrogen after being added dropwise to complete In sodium hydroxide solution regulation four-hole boiling flask, mixture pH is to neutrality;
(3)After above-mentioned pH is adjusted, four-hole boiling flask is put standing 1~2h at room temperature, then carry out filtration under diminished pressure, collect filter residue, and 2~3 times of deionized water of filter residue and its quality is mixed, then is spray-dried, collect dried object, obtain modified para arrowroot Powder, standby;
(4)Count by weight, take 42~44 portions of sucrose, 32~36 parts of peptones, 26~28 parts of yeast extracts, 7~9 parts of bright ammonia Acid, 1~2 part of streptomysin, 3~6 parts of petroleum ethers and 2~4 parts of ammonium citrates, stir, and put into sterilized in high-temperature sterilization pot Sterilization, obtains screening and culturing medium, by inoculum concentration 10~15%, bacillus stearothermophilus is seeded to screening and culturing medium, and will connect Screening and culturing medium after kind is placed in constant incubator, and design temperature is 57~62 DEG C, cultivates 20~24h;
(5)After culture terminates, screening and culturing medium is taken out, screen media surface using sterilized water drip washing, until its surface No mycelia, collection leacheate, in mass ratio 1:3~1:5, by leacheate and step(3)Standby modified tapioca starch puts into appearance Mix in device, and by after container standing 2~3h under the conditions of 57~62 DEG C, add in container leacheate quality 30~ 40% chitin, then container is placed in sterilizing under ultraviolet sterilizing lamp, you can obtain modified starch Cypres.
The application process of the present invention:First fluting medium is laid on glass plate on request, and one end is fixed Afterwards, modified starch Cypres prepared by the present invention are spread evenly across on the body paper after fixing, control the amount being coated with to be 25 ~35g/m2, after end to be coated, after the paper natural air drying 3~5min after applying glue, then it is placed in temperature for 90~105 DEG C of bakings 1~3min is dried in dry machine.
After testing, the film being formed after the modified starch Cypres coating of present invention preparation is not easy to crack, not moisture-sensitive, The paper flat crushing strength obtaining reaches more than 96N, and side pressure strength reaches more than 765N/m, falls bits amount and is less than 1.025g/m2.
Compared with additive method, Advantageous Effects are the present invention:
(1)The film being formed after the modified starch Cypres coating of present invention preparation is not easy to crack, not moisture-sensitive, tear index Reach 38.65~41.25mN m2/ g, improves intensity and the water repelling property of paper;
(2)The modified starch Cypres of present invention preparation are higher with the adhesion of paper, and decrease paper falls bits amount, and Fall bits amount and be less than 1.025g/m2
(3)The modified starch Cypres of present invention preparation are not susceptible to go mouldy, and easily store, and glue applying method is simple, have wide Wealthy application prospect.
